>>>>I'm a little confused; Many posters acknowledge that a 9mm out of a carbine-length barrel is equal to a .357 and endorse the .357 as adequate for deer out of a revolver, yet condemn the 9mm as a deer round even though Spadone pointed out that the range is under 30 yards. Could someone explain this discrepancy?<<<<<<

With the .357 you're going to use a 180-200 grain cast bullet with enough momentum to EXIT and leave a blood trail (at least on a light deer), that's a DEER LOAD.

There is no comparable load in 9mm. Will a 9mm hollowpoint kill a deer? I think it will. Will you find the deer? Maybe... sometimes.

Any load from any caliber should exit the game being shot. If it doesn't exit, it shouldn't be used.
